Precision Performance: Offers low offset voltage (typically 50 µV maximum) and low offset voltage drift, ensuring high accuracy over temperature variations.Low Power Consumption: Features low quiescent current (typically 1.5 mA), making it suitable for battery-powered or energy-efficient applications.Low Noise: Provides low input voltage noise (typically 8 nV/?Hz at 1 kHz), ideal for amplifying low-level signals.Single Supply Operation: Can operate from a single power supply ranging from 5V to 24V (or dual supplies from ±2.5V to ±12V).Rail-to-Rail Output: The output can swing very close to the positive and negative supply rails, maximizing the dynamic range.High CMRR/PSRR: Features high common-mode rejection ratio (CMRR) and power supply rejection ratio (PSRR), ensuring stable operation even with noisy power supplies or common-mode signals.Wide Bandwidth: Has a wide gain bandwidth product (typically 5 MHz), enabling accurate amplification of a broad range of frequencies.
